#main-area {	position: relative;	top: 0;	left: 0;	width: 2560px;	/*height: 5294px;*/}#recruit_mainvis {	position: relative;	top: 0;	left: 0;	width: 2560px;	height: 750px;	background-repeat: no-repeat;	background-image: url("../../common/images/recruit/recruit_mainvis_img.jpg");	background-position: 0 0;}#recruit_mainvis_txt {	position: absolute;	top: 288px;	left: 1147px;}#recruit_area01 {	position: relative;	width: 2560px;	height: 1138px;	background-repeat: no-repeat;	background-image: url("../../common/images/recruit/recruit_area01_bg.jpg");	background-position: 0 0;}#recruit_area01_title_img {	position: absolute;	top: 167px;	left: 1157px;}#recruit_area01_title_txt_ym_m {	position: absolute;	top: 273px;	left: 1225px;	height: 18px;	font-size: 18px;	text-align: center;	color: #626262;}#recruit_area01_txt_img {	position: absolute;	top: 415px;	left: 1050px;}#recruit_area01_des_txt_ym_m {	position: absolute;	top: 544px;	left: 976px;	height: 136px;	font-size: 16px;	text-align: center;	color: #626262;	line-height: 30px;}#recruit_area01_btn {	position: absolute;	top: 806px;	left: 1135px;}#recruit_area02 {	position: relative;	width: 2560px;	height: 1287px;	background-repeat: no-repeat;	background-image: url("../../common/images/recruit/recruit_area02_bg.jpg");	background-position: 0 0;}#recruit_area02_title_img {	position: absolute;	top: 63px;	left: 1092px;}#recruit_area02_title_txt_ym_m {	position: absolute;	top: 168px;	left: 1243px;	height: 18px;	font-size: 18px;	text-align: center;	color: #626262;}#recruit_area02_ym_m {	position: absolute;	top: 223px;	left: 856px;	width: 847px;	height: 912px;}#recruit_area02_ym_m tr {	border-bottom: solid 1px #626262;}#recruit_area02_ym_m tr:last-child {	border: none;}#recruit_area02_ym_m th {	color: #12a6e4;	padding-left: 40px;	width: 218px;	text-align: left;	position: absolute;	margin-top: 12px;}#recruit_area02_ym_m td {	color: #626262;	vertical-align: middle;	text-align: left;	padding-left: 218px;	padding-right: 38px;}#recruit_area03 {	position: relative;	width: 2560px;	height: 1585px;	background-repeat: no-repeat;	background-image: url("../../common/images/recruit/recruit_area03_bg.jpg");	background-position: 0 0;}#recruit_area03_title_img {	position: absolute;	top: 64px;	left: 1177px;}#recruit_area03_title_txt_ym_m {	position: absolute;	top: 169px;	left: 1216px;	height: 18px;	font-size: 18px;	text-align: center;	color: #626262;}#recruit_area03_step01 {	position: absolute;	top: 287px;	left: 377px;	width: 1503px;	height: 260px;	background-repeat: no-repeat;	background-image: url("../../common/images/recruit/recruit_area03_step01_img.png");	background-position: 0 0;}#recruit_area03_step01_title_img {	position: absolute;	top: 34px;	left: 837px;}#recruit_area03_step01_title_txt_ym_m {	position: absolute;	top: 101px;	left: 880px;	height: 16px;	font-size: 16px;	text-align: center;	color: #FFFFFF;}#recruit_area03_step01_des_txt_ym_m {	position: absolute;	top: 147px;	left: 652px;	height: 40px;	font-size: 16px;	text-align: center;	color: #FFFFFF;	line-height: 24px;}#recruit_area03_step02 {	position: absolute;	top: 579px;	left: 682px;	width: 1504px;	height: 260px;	background-repeat: no-repeat;	background-image: url("../../common/images/recruit/recruit_area03_step02_img.png");	background-position: 0 0;}#recruit_area03_step02_title_img {	position: absolute;	top: 35px;	left: 498px;}#recruit_area03_step02_title_txt_ym_m {	position: absolute;	top: 101px;	left: 583px;	height: 16px;	font-size: 16px;	text-align: center;	color: #FFFFFF;}#recruit_area03_step02_des_txt_ym_m {	position: absolute;	top: 147px;	left: 459px;	height: 40px;	font-size: 16px;	text-align: center;	color: #FFFFFF;}#recruit_area03_step03 {	position: absolute;	top: 868px;	left: 377px;	width: 1502px;	height: 260px;	background-repeat: no-repeat;	background-image: url("../../common/images/recruit/recruit_area03_step03_img.png");	background-position: 0 0;}#recruit_area03_step03_title_img {	position: absolute;	top: 35px;	left: 802px;}#recruit_area03_step03_title_txt_ym_m {	position: absolute;	top: 101px;	left: 888px;	height: 16px;	font-size: 16px;	text-align: center;	color: #FFFFFF;}#recruit_area03_step03_des_txt_ym_m {	position: absolute;	top: 146px;	left: 796px;	height: 40px;	font-size: 16px;	text-align: center;	color: #FFFFFF;}#recruit_area03_step04 {	position: absolute;	top: 1159px;	left: 677px;	width: 1509px;	height: 260px;	background-repeat: no-repeat;	background-image: url("../../common/images/recruit/recruit_area03_step04_title_img_ym.png");	background-position: 479px 35px;	background-repeat: no-repeat;	background-image: url("../../common/images/recruit/recruit_area03_step04_img.png");	background-position: 0 0;}#recruit_area03_step04_title_txt_ym_m {	position: absolute;	top: 101px;	left: 532px;	height: 16px;	font-size: 16px;	text-align: center;	color: #FFFFFF;}#recruit_area03_step04_des_txt_ym_m {	position: absolute;	top: 145px;	left: 409px;	height: 41px;	font-size: 16px;	text-align: center;	color: #FFFFFF;}#recruit_area04 {	position: relative;	width: 2560px;	height: 626px;	background-repeat: no-repeat;	background-image: url("../../common/images/recruit/recruit_area04_bg.jpg");	background-position: 0 0;}#recruit_area04_title_img {	position: absolute;	top: 99px;	left: 1172px;}#recruit_area04_title_txt_ym_m {	position: absolute;	top: 206px;	left: 1236px;	height: 16px;	font-size: 16px;	text-align: center;	color: #FFFFFF;}#recruit_area04_des_txt_ym_m {	position: absolute;	top: 272px;	left: 1125px;	height: 16px;	font-size: 16px;	text-align: center;	color: #FFFFFF;}#recruit_area04_tel_btn {	position: absolute;	top: 325px;	left: 1135px;}